A Julia package for coral reef site assessment and suitability analysis. ReefGuide provides tools for evaluating potential deployment locations on coral reefs based on multiple environmental criteria including depth, slope, turbidity, wave conditions, and rugosity.
ReefGuide.jl is a library allowing for processing Site Selection and Regional Assessment jobs in the reefguide system.

First, specify your data directory and load the regional datasets. For the data spec, see spec.
using ReefGuide
# Point to your data directory containing regional GeoTIFF and Parquet files
data_dir = "/path/to/your/data"
regional_data = initialise_data(data_dir)
The initialise_data()
function loads:
- Regional raster stacks (depth, slope, turbidity, wave data, etc.)
- Slope lookup tables with valid reef coordinates
- Canonical reef outline geometries
- Computed criteria bounds for each region

The package supports assessment based on:
- Depth - Water depth from mean astronomical tide
- Slope - Reef slope angle in degrees
- Turbidity - Water clarity (Secchi depth)
- Wave Height - Significant wave height (90th percentile)
- Wave Period - Time between waves (90th percentile)
- Rugosity - Sea floor roughness (Townsville region only)

File Type | Format | Pattern | Regions | Purpose |
---|---|---|---|---|
Slope Lookup Table | Parquet | {region}_valid_slopes_lookup.parq |
All (4 files) | Point data with coordinates and environmental values for valid reef locations |
Valid Extent Raster | GeoTIFF | {region}_valid_slopes.tif |
All (4 files) | Binary mask indicating valid reef slope areas |
Depth Raster | GeoTIFF | {region}*_bathy.tif |
All (4 files) | Bathymetry data from Mean Astronomical Tide |
Slope Raster | GeoTIFF | {region}*_slope.tif |
All (4 files) | Reef slope angles in degrees |
Turbidity Raster | GeoTIFF | {region}*_turbid.tif |
All (4 files) | Water clarity (Secchi depth in meters) |
Wave Height Raster | GeoTIFF | {region}*_waves_Hs.tif |
All (4 files) | Significant wave height, 90th percentile (meters) |
Wave Period Raster | GeoTIFF | {region}*_waves_Tp.tif |
All (4 files) | Wave period, 90th percentile (seconds) |
Rugosity Raster | GeoTIFF | {region}*_rugosity.tif |
Townsville only (1 file) | Sea floor roughness (standard deviation) |
Reef Outlines | GeoPackage | rrap_canonical_outlines.gpkg |
Global (1 file) | Canonical reef boundary geometries |

Total Files Required: 30 files
- 1 global reef outlines file
- 4 regions × 7 files each (5 base criteria + lookup + extent)
- 1 additional rugosity file for Townsville
Note: The *
in filenames represents potential additional naming components that may exist between the region ID and the criteria suffix, as the code uses glob pattern matching to find files.
